I have an opportunity to get some really nice GTI leather seats for a steal. The catch is the car they are coming out of was in an accident and the drivers seat airbag went off. It didn't damage the leather and just the stitches were damaged. Is it possible to just replace the airbag and stitch up the seat cover? I searched and found next to nothing on the subject. Also, are all the MK4 airbags compatible? Can I just go to a pull-a-part and remove an airbag from a mk4 golf/jetta there and transplant it over?

For the record, I am getting all the seats for $250. Should I just move on and keep looking or is this an easy fix?

I walked away from the deal. I contacted several auto upholstery shops and nobody would touch it due to liability.
